Automated warning for delayed deliveries

Purpose

1.1. Automate notifications for purchase orders or deliveries not received on time, providing real-time alerts to management and suppliers.
1.2. Enables automating escalation chains for critical supply shortages, ensuring minimal disruption to vendor and kitchen operations.
1.3. Automates root cause data capture for late deliveries, supports issue logging and vendor performance analytics.
1.4. Automates communication for remedial action, aiding vendor compliance and optimizing future procurement processes.

Trigger Conditions

2.1. Automated trigger when expected delivery timestamp lapses without item status update to “received.”
2.2. Automation can trigger from supplier invoice not marked fulfilled in ERP or procurement system after threshold duration.
2.3. Automates from warehouse or receiving dock marking purchase order as incomplete post scheduled time.

Platform variants

3.1. Twilio SMS
• Feature/Setting: Use Programmable Messaging API; automate phone alerts by configuring trigger from your procurement system upon late delivery.
3.2. SendGrid
• Feature/Setting: Configure Transactional Email API; automates email to vendor/manager for each missed delivery mark.
3.3. Slack
• Feature/Setting: Configure Incoming Webhooks in Slack; automate warning notification to relevant food court ops channel.
3.4. Microsoft Teams
• Feature/Setting: Use Teams Connector API; set up automation to post alert card in designated team channel on delayed delivery.
3.5. WhatsApp Business API
• Feature/Setting: Use Messages endpoint; automates templated WhatsApp outreach to supplier in real-time.
3.6. SAP ERP
• Feature/Setting: Use the Procurement Module Events; automate warning output to data integration service triggering notifications.
3.7. Oracle NetSuite
• Feature/Setting: Schedule scripts with SuiteScript; automates email or task triggers on late purchase receipts.
3.8. Salesforce Service Cloud
• Feature/Setting: Automate Case Creation API; generate a warning case when delivery date not met in records.
3.9. Freshdesk
• Feature/Setting: Automates ticket creation via API for any supplier whose delivery is overdue.
3.10. Zendesk
• Feature/Setting: Automate Zendesk support ticket via API to log delayed delivery issue.
3.11. Google Sheets
• Feature/Setting: Use Apps Script; automate flag in sheet + trigger email when “received” column stays blank past due.
3.12. Monday.com
• Feature/Setting: Use automations to change delivery item status and send warning alert to board owner.
3.13. Asana
• Feature/Setting: Automated rule to create task or comment when delivery field is overdue.
3.14. Airtable
• Feature/Setting: Use automation triggers; send notification and update status when delivery not marked completed.
3.15. Zapier
• Feature/Setting: Automate multi-platform workflows: delayed delivery in source app triggers connected actions.
3.16. Pipedream
• Feature/Setting: Automate code workflow; monitor procurement DB/API, send SMS/email if delay detected.
3.17. ServiceNow
• Feature/Setting: Use Flow Designer; automate incident record for delayed supplier delivery.
3.18. BambooHR
• Feature/Setting: Automate notification to team on procurement delays affecting scheduled food court shifts.
3.19. Outlook (Microsoft 365)
• Feature/Setting: Automate flagged delivery emails via Flow, filter and forward overdue alerts to managers.
3.20. Google Chat
• Feature/Setting: Configure bots/webhook; automate delivery warning messages to the purchasing chat room.
3.21. Trello
• Feature/Setting: Automation (Butler); auto-create cards and notify users when deliveries are late.

Benefits

4.1. Automates early warning and fast escalation, reducing operational disruption in street food supply chains.
4.2. Enables automated, auditable vendor performance history to optimize supplier selection and retention.
4.3. Automated notifications reduce manual tracking, freeing staff for high-value tasks.
4.4. Automates cross-platform coordination for incident resolution, boosting overall food court efficiency.
4.5. Supports automating compliance reporting and contractual penalty triggers.
